About the role: Raytheon UK - a global Manufacturing Engineering leader in the Aerospace and Defence industry have an exciting opportunity for a qualified electronics professional to join the team and make a real difference to a range of Test Electronics projects. As a Senior Product Test Engineer you'll demonstrate a range of professional electronics skills such as debug, working on high reliability electronics products, work to component level and the highest standards to deliver products to our customers. This role is a blend of electronic test engineering supporting manufacturing production projects.

You will be qualified in an Electronics subject at degree, post-graduate or HND (or equivalent) levels. You'll be knowledgeable in the field of electronics and have experience either working in a defence and/or military environment. Experience in an electronics or electronics-manufacturing company testing & fault finding electronic assemblies to component level, fault finding, presenting data and showing expertise in these areas is ideal for the role.

Skills and Experience Requirements

  • Test Lifecycle
  • Presenting data to teams
  • Diagnostics, fault finding, debug and corrective action
  • Mentor other staff e.g. diagnostic technicians
  • Design for Manufacturing and Design for Test (DFM/DFT) implementation
  • Military or high reliability manufacturing electronics
  • Challenge status quo, present new ideas
  • Work on range of electronic technologies

Benefits and Work Culture

  • Competitive salaries.
  • 25 days holiday + statutory public holidays, plus opportunity to buy and sell up to 5 days (37hr)
  • Contributory Pension Scheme (up to 10.5% company contribution)
  • Company bonus scheme (discretionary).
  • 6 times salary 'Life Assurance' with pension.
  • Flexible Benefits scheme with extensive salary sacrifice schemes, including Health Cashplan, Dental, and Cycle to Work amongst others.
  • Enhanced sick pay.
  • Enhanced family friendly policies including enhanced maternity, paternity & shared parental leave.
  • Car / Car allowance (dependant on grade/ role)
  • Private Medical Insurance (dependant on grade)

Work Culture

  • 37hr working week, although hours may vary depending on role, job requirement or site-specific arrangements.
  • Early 1.30pm finish Friday, start your weekend early!
  • Remote, hybrid and site based working opportunities, dependant on your needs and the requirements of the role.
  • A grownup flexible working culture that is output, not time spent at desk, focussed. More formal flexible working arrangements can also be requested and assessed subject to the role.
  • Up to 5 paid days volunteering each year.
